ecshop的支付方式顺序本身是没有办法修改的,这是程序本身的bug,但是毕竟ecshop程序是开源的,所以我们可以通过简单修改一下代码实现可以修改“支付方式”的显示顺序,首先找到文件:includes/lib_compositor.php if(isset($modules)) { } ?> 将这个之间的内容删除后在中间插入: /* 将支付宝提升至第一个显示 */ foreach ($modules as $k =>$v) { if($v['pay_code'] == 'alipay') { $tenpay = $modules[$k]; unset($modules[$k]); array_unshift($modules, $tenpay); } }
|